Indications It's Time for an Upgrade
How does a property owner know when it is time to repair double glazing versus totally change? While small drafts can often be fixed with brand-new weatherstripping, certain indicators point straight to the need for overall replacement.
Secret Indicators for Replacement:
- Drafts and Air Leaks: If curtains flutter when windows are closed, or if a visible chill is felt nearby, the seals have actually failed.
- Condensation Between Panes: Fogging or moisture trapped in between glass repairs near me layers suggests that the insulated glass system (IGU) seal has broken.
- Physical Damage: Rotted wood, split vinyl, warped frames, or sticking sashes that require strength to open and close.
- High Energy Bills: A sudden, inexplicable spike in heating & cooling costs frequently traces back to failing thermal barriers in doors and windows.
- Fading Interiors: Carpets, wood floorings, and furniture fading near windows suggest an absence of appropriate UV-blocking glass coatings.
Selecting the Right Materials
Picking the right frame product is crucial for durability, upkeep, and aesthetic appeals. Each product features its own unique set of pros and cons.

Making The Most Of Energy Efficiency
When investing in replacements, energy effectiveness must be a top concern. House owners ought to try to find particular ratings and accreditations to guarantee they are getting a high-performing item.
- ENERGY STAR ® Certification: Products bearing this label fulfill stringent energy-efficiency standards set by the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ency.
- Low-E Glass Coatings: Microscopically thin, transparent metal layers show heat back to its source-- keeping interiors warm in the winter and cool in the summer season-- while blocking damaging UV rays.
- Gas Fills: The area between window panes is typically filled with argon or krypton gas, which is denser than air and provides superior thermal insulation.
- U-Factor and Solar Heat Gain Coefficient (SHGC): Look for low U-factor numbers (showing much better insulation) and a suitable SHGC depending upon the local climate.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. How much does a common window and door replacement cost?
The expense varies widely based on the materials selected, the size of the home, the number of openings, and labor rates. On average, basic vinyl window replacements can vary from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window set up, while premium wood or fiberglass systems can cost considerably more. Outside doors typically vary from ₤ 1,000 to ₤ 4,000+ depending on customized functions, sidelites, and products.
2. Can I change my doors and windows in the winter season?
Yes! Experienced setup crews can replace windows and doors year-round. They normally work space by space to decrease direct exposure to the outside components, sealing each opening quickly before carrying on to the next.
3. Should I replace all my windows simultaneously or can I do it in stages?
While changing all windows simultaneously is more economical in terms of labor and guarantees an uniform appearance, staging the project over time is a typical method to handle budget plans. Lots of house owners begin with the street-facing side of your home or the rooms that suffer the most from draftiness.
4. How long do replacement windows and doors last?
High-quality vinyl, fiberglass, and clad-wood Upvc windows repair normally last in between 20 to 40 years when effectively installed and preserved. Entry doors can last similarly long, though surfaces on wooden doors may need touch-ups or resealing every couple of years.
